



TechGirls is an international summer exchange program designed to inspire and empower girls, ages 15–17, from around the world—including the United States—to pursue careers in science, technology, engineering, and math (STEM).
In partnership with the U.S. Department of State and Legacy International, BRAVE Communities is thrilled to welcome a cohort of 20 TechGirls from Cambodia, Fiji, Indonesia, Mongolia, Taiwan, Vietnam, and the U.S. to Austin from July 26–30, 2025.
Together, we’ll explore innovation, foster cross-cultural friendships, and shape the next generation of changemakers in STEM!
